A company in the insect processing, production, or supply industry.
5
Funding Rounds
$234.9m
Money raised
Name | Phone | Social networks | |
---|---|---|---|
Au** Gu* |
|
- | |
Cl***** Ra* |
|
- | |
Ba***** Og**** |
|
- |